UPVC Windows Near Me

uPVC can be made in various styles to match any aesthetic. They are also extremely durable and provide excellent energy efficiency. This helps lower the cost of energy at home and reduce the amount of pollution.

UPVC is termite-proof and doesn't encourage other insects. Furthermore they are simple to maintain. They can be cleaned using a damp cloth, and they do not require painting or sanding.

UPVC is a tough material

UPVC can be used to create doors and windows. This environmentally friendly material is resistant to corrosion and rot as well as UV damage. UPVC can also be used to insulate your home. This can reduce the cost of energy and improve your comfort. These advantages are the reason why UPVC windows and doors so popular with homeowners.

Unlike wooden frames uPVC is not susceptible to rot or grow fungi. uPVC is therefore an excellent choice for tropical or subtropical climates. In addition, UPVC doesn't warp or swell due to rain or humidity, so it will remain stable and functional for the years to come. UPVC is also low maintenance and simple to clean with soapy water.

Aside from being a durable material, UPVC is also a fire-resistant material and will not melt or change shape in the event of an incident. Its toughness makes UPVC an excellent option for homeowners who live in high-rise buildings or other urban settings. UPVC is also a great sound insulator that can help reduce noise pollution from traffic and other sources in your workplace or at home.

UPVC windows are also easy to maintain unlike aluminium or wood. UPVC requires little maintenance and can be cleaned with soapy water and a sponge. This low-maintenance option is particularly useful for busy urban homeowners who don't have time to maintain their homes. UPVC is able to last between 40 and 80 years, which makes it a great choice for people who wish to cut back on maintenance expenses.

UPVC windows are designed to be more efficient in energy use than metal or wooden frames. They accomplish this by preventing heat to escape in the winter, and keeping cool air inside during the summer. UPVC windows also are impermeable to air, which can reduce energy bills and prevent heat transfer. UPVC is an extremely energy-efficient choice for windows. This aligns with Oyster Lifestyle's commitment to sustainability.

It is energy efficient.

uPVC is not only durable but also energy efficient. Their insulation properties help keep homes warm in winter and cool during summer. Additionally, they cut down on the energy required to run ACs or heaters. This helps you save money on your utility bills. Additionally, uPVC is an eco-friendly material that is recyclable and reused time and time again.

Upvc windows and doors are gap-proof and prevent the entry of dust and other pollutant. This makes them an appealing alternative to wooden windows that are more susceptible to dirt and moisture. It is also easy to clean and is the ideal option for busy families.

uPVC window repair near me decors have another benefit. They are available in a broad variety of finishes and colours and can be designed to look like natural wood. These windows are also termite proof, meaning that they will not be affected by pests.

They are extremely energy-efficient especially when you choose double or triple glazing. The additional insulating bars and gas-filled units can reduce heat loss by as much as 30%. They also provide excellent sound insulation that creates a more tranquil and quieter indoor environment. These features can help reduce your energy use and increase the value of your home.

Upvc windows are low-maintenance and last for a long time without cracking or warping. They are tough and are a great investment for your home. They are also resistant to corrosion, termites, and fading. This is the reason they are a good option for coastal areas.

uPVC is not just energy efficient but also eco-friendly. Its lifespan is of 40-80 years. It is made up of recyclable materials, which has a minimal impact on the environment over time. They are a superior alternative to wood, which reduces deforestation. uPVC is also recyclable and can be used in many different products, including pipes, plumbing fittings and more.

Easy to maintain

If you're looking for windows that are easy to maintain and durable, then uPVC could be the best option for your home. Its low-porous surface doesn't accumulate dirt or bacteria and is easy to clean with soapy water. It also has a high thermal insulation value, which helps keep your house warm in winter and cool during summer. This can lower your electric bills, and aid in the conservation of the earth. Additionally, it's perfect for coastal areas and high-rise structures, since it's resistant to strong winds and heavy rains.

uPVC windows are available in a wide range of colours and styles. Many homeowners opt to buy them because they are affordable and long-lasting, and add value to their homes. They can be customised to match your home's interior design. Additionally, uPVC windows are energy efficient and can help you save money on your heating bill. Nevertheless, they require regular maintenance to prevent damage. Cleaning them with a soft cloth soaked in soapy water is the most effective way to maintain them. You should also lubricate their hinges and handles at least twice a year to stop them from stiffening.

If your uPVC windows are damaged or need repairs A reputable uPVC repair service can assist you. They will inspect the frames of your windows and make any necessary window repairs near me. They will also provide tips on how to avoid damage to your uPVC windows in the near future.

UPVC is a very popular material for doors and windows because it is easy to maintain and has a low porosity that does not attract dirt or bacteria. It's also a good insulation and can be used in locations that have high levels of air pollution or humidity. Moreover, UPVC is an excellent material for windows with sash because it offers superior weather resistance and better airflow.

Upvc windows are among the most durable and long-lasting building materials available. They are easy to maintain and will last for many years. The uPVC frames and sashes of the doors are resistant to the harsh weather conditions like hail winds, snow, and rain. They also have high energy efficiency. Furthermore, they offer excellent ventilation and protect your property from intruders.

It is reasonably priced.

UPVC windows offer great value compared to their timber or aluminium counterparts. They are also extremely durable and offer superior thermal performance, which can lower household expenses. UPVC windows look beautiful and are available in a range of colors. They are easy to maintain and clean. They also offer sound insulation.

If you're looking to replace windows in your new home or to upgrade your period cottage, uPVC can be a good choice. They are strong and can be made to look like wooden frames from the past. They are also low maintenance and energy efficient, which could help to cut your energy bills.

The cost of uPVC windows depends on the type and style you select. For instance, you can choose fully opening casement windows that are side-hung and open outwards, tilt and turn windows, that open in a variety of directions (great for ventilation) or bay and bow windows, which create a curved projection from your home. You can also get windows with a variety of furniture and handles to match your interior design and enhance the overall appearance.

uPVC Windows are available in a range of colours to complement your home. White is the most popular. However, this may not be the best choice for your home especially if you reside in a cottage, so it's important to find a colour that complements the rest of your property.

Begin by asking your friends and family members for recommendations. You can also ask neighbours whether they've had their windows recently installed and If yes what company they used. Community forums and online reviews are a great source of information as well.

Timber windows are generally favored by some people due to the fact that they are less harmful to the environment. They are also visually appealing and feel more solid than uPVC. This is the reason why they are usually used in traditional homes. They can also be painted to match your existing interior color scheme.
